Margaret Weichert Joins Primis Financial Board
With a three-decade career spanning global banking, government oversight, and fintech innovation, Margaret M. Weichert has been elected to the Board of Directors at Primis Financial Corp. Her appointment signals a strategic push by the McLean-based institution to sharpen its technological edge in an increasingly digital financial landscape.

Weichert brings a multifaceted background to the board, having held leadership roles at Accenture, Bank of America, and First Data. Her experience extends beyond the private sector, including service as a Senate-confirmed official at the Office of Management and Budget and the Office of Personnel Management. As an inventor, she holds sixteen U.S. patents, with expertise ranging from artificial intelligence and cloud computing to blockchain and payment systems.
Dennis J. Zember, Jr., President and CEO of Primis, highlighted that the company’s recent engagement with Weichert confirmed her as a critical asset for their goals. As the firm looks to scale its operations—currently managing $4.3 billion in total assets across Virginia and Maryland—her blend of entrepreneurial spirit and institutional knowledge is expected to influence the bank's long-term digital strategy. Weichert currently balances her professional commitments as an Adjunct Professor at Georgetown University and as an advisor to various fintech startups.
